The first English novel appeared in
goblinko [34]

Answer:

En el siglo XVIII se dieron las primeras grandes novelas en inglés. a principios de siglo aparecen Robinson Crusoe y Moll Flanders de Defoe, y Los viajes de Gulliver de Jonathan Swift, que siguen la tradición de la Restauración inglesa, y la crítica considera previas a la novela moderna inglesa.
